Jamie Sims is a Senior Lecturer at the School of Sport, Nutrition and Allied Health Professions at Oxford Brookes University. With qualifications including a DPhil from Oxford and multiple MSc and BSc degrees, Sims specializes in behavioural epidemiology, focusing on public health interventions for non-communicable diseases like type 2 diabetes.
Research interests include:
- Epidemiology of health behaviours
- Environmental impacts on well-being
- Greenspaces and blue spaces
- Healthy placemaking through built environment design
Selected publications examine topics like AAS use and pandemic health risks, environmental health disparities, and childhood physical activity interventions. Sims also serves as Deputy Research Ethics Officer for the School of Health and Life Sciences and is a Fellow of the Higher Education Academy.
